The documentation suggests that Intel vtune 2025 will run on Rocky linux 8 and 9
When we install it on Rocky 8 it requires a GLIBc version that is only available on Rocky 9.
Where can I download a version that will install on Rocky 8 please or/AND Will this be fixed ?

Hi Greg,
Kindly follow below workarounds for Intel® VTune™ Profiler :
- Clear LD_PRELOAD before launching VTune and configure LD_PRELOAD as an environment for the target application if it is required.
- Add libstdc++.so.6 either from VTune installation or from system location to LD_PRELOAD (see https://www.intel.com/content/www/us/en/docs/vtune-profiler/user-guide/2023-0/error-message-cannot-collect-gpu-hardware-metrics.html that has a similar workaround)
- Do 'export LD_PROFILE=none' before launching collection (this could cause an insignificant performance hit for the loader, does not work in security hardened environment)
